Occupying the third floor of Claridge House, this impressive apartment unfolds across approximately 2,204 sq ft, combining classical proportions with a confident sense of scale in one of Mayfair’s most established red-brick mansion buildings. South-west facing and flooded with natural light, the apartment is defined by its generosity of volume, period detailing and a layout that lends itself as easily to elegant entertaining as it does to day-to-day living.
The heart of the home is a magnificent double reception and dining room, stretching over 21 feet in length and framed by tall sash windows that draw light deep into the space throughout the afternoon and evening. With ceiling heights of just over 10 feet, original cornicing and a striking Art Deco fireplace, the room has a stately presence without feeling formal. Parquet flooring runs underfoot, grounding the space and allowing the scale of the room to speak for itself, while clearly defined seating and dining areas make it as practical as it is impressive.
Set slightly apart, the kitchen is accessed from the central hallway. Well proportioned and thoughtfully laid out, it sits comfortably away from the main reception spaces, allowing for a clear separation between entertaining and service areas. A generous utility room nearby provides additional storage and practicality, alongside discreet guest cloakrooms.
The principal bedroom suite occupies a prime position within the apartment, offering excellent proportions and a private atmosphere. With space for a seating area as well as substantial wardrobes, it is served by a well-appointed ensuite bathroom. Two further bedrooms are arranged along the inner hallway, each comfortably sized and sharing access to two additional bathrooms, making the apartment well suited to family living, guests or a dedicated study or dressing room.
Throughout, the apartment retains a strong sense of architectural integrity. Original detailing has been preserved and balanced with subtle modern interventions, allowing the space to feel polished but not overworked. The result is a home that feels confident, established and quietly luxurious, with proportions that are increasingly rare in central London.
Claridge House is a well-regarded portered building, positioned at the heart of Mayfair and moments from Grosvenor Square. Davies Street places the boutiques of Bond Street, the restaurants of Mount Street and the open green space of Hyde Park all within easy reach, while excellent transport connections are close at hand via Bond Street and Green Park. It is a location that offers both the energy of the West End and the reassurance of one of London’s most enduring residential neighbourhoods.
